Ingredients for Air Fryer Five Cheese Baked Mac & Cheese

Here’s the lineup for the creamiest, cheesiest mac you’ll ever make – every ingredient plays a special role in this flavor party:

  • 8 oz elbow macaroni – the classic shape holds all that cheesy goodness perfectly
  • 2 tbsp butter – salted or unsalted both work, this starts our dreamy sauce
  • 2 tbsp all-purpose flour – our thickening superhero for the roux
  • 1 cup whole milk – don’t skimp here, the fat makes the sauce luxe
  • 1/2 cup heavy cream – because we’re going for maximum indulgence
  • 1/2 cup sharp cheddar, shredded – the bold backbone of our cheese blend
  • 1/2 cup whole-milk mozzarella, shredded – for that epic stretch factor
  • 1/4 cup smoked gouda, shredded – adds a subtle, irresistible smokiness
  • 1/4 cup parmesan, freshly grated – brings the salty, nutty punch
  • 1/4 cup cream cheese, cubed – tiny cubes melt into creaminess
  • 1/2 tsp kosher salt – enhances all those cheesy flavors
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per – freshly ground is best
  • 1/4 tsp smoked paprika – just enough to make it interesting

How to Make Air Fryer Five Cheese Baked Mac & Cheese

Okay, let’s dive into making this cheesy masterpiece! Follow these simple steps and you’ll have the most incredible mac & cheese ready in no time.

Preparing the Cheese Sauce

First, melt your butter in that saucepan over medium heat – you’ll know it’s ready when it stops foaming. Now here’s the key: whisk in the flour and keep stirring for about a minute. This cooks out that raw flour taste and gives us the perfect roux base. Slowly pour in your milk and cream while whisking constantly – this is how we avoid those pesky lumps. Once it’s smooth and slightly thickened (about 3 minutes), reduce the heat to low and start adding your cheeses one at a time. I always start with the cheddar and mozzarella, then the gouda and parmesan, saving those cream cheese cubes for last. Keep stirring gently until you’ve got the silkiest cheese sauce you’ve ever seen!

Combining and Air Frying

Now for the fun part! Mix your cooked macaroni into that glorious cheese sauce until every noodle is coated. Transfer it all to your air fryer-safe dish – don’t worry if it looks soupy, that’s perfect! Pop it into the air fryer at 350°F for about 10 minutes. Here’s my insider tip: give it a quick stir at the 5-minute mark to ensure even crisping. You’ll know it’s done when the top gets those irresistible golden spots and the edges are bubbling. Let it sit for just a couple minutes before serving – I know it’s hard to wait, but this helps the sauce thicken up perfectly!

Tips for Perfect Air Fryer Five Cheese Baked Mac & Cheese

Want to take your mac from great to legendary? These little tricks make all the difference:

  • Room temp is best: Take your cheeses out 30 minutes early – they’ll melt into the smoothest sauce without clumping.
  • Crisp it up: For extra golden goodness, give it a quick 1-2 minute broil at the end (watch closely!).
  • Patience pays off: Let it rest 5 minutes after air frying – the sauce thickens perfectly as it cools slightly.
  • Stir halfway: Don’t skip that mid-cook stir! It gives you crispy bits everywhere, not just on top.
  • Fresh is fabulous: Grate your own cheeses – the pre-shredded stuff has anti-caking agents that make sauces grainy.

Variations & Substitutions

Oh, the fun you can have with this recipe! Swap that gouda for gruyère if you’re feeling fancy – it melts like a dream. Out of mozzarella? Try Monterey Jack instead. Want some crunch? Toss in panko breadcrumbs before air frying. Feeling indulgent? Crispy bacon bits or sautéed mushrooms take this mac to the next level. Vegetarian? Skip the bacon and add roasted red peppers or broccoli florets. The beauty is – as long as you’ve got that creamy cheese base, the possibilities are endless!

Storing and Reheating

Here’s the best way to keep your mac & cheese tasting fresh (though let’s be real – leftovers rarely last long in my house!). Store it in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. When reheating, skip the microwave – it’ll turn your creamy masterpiece into a rubbery mess. Instead, pop it back in the air fryer at 300°F for about 5 minutes. That magic hot air will bring back that perfect crispy top and gooey center like it’s fresh from the first bake!

FAQs About Air Fryer Five Cheese Baked Mac & Cheese

Can I use gluten-free pasta? Absolutely! Just swap regular elbows for your favorite GF pasta – the sauce won’t know the difference. Keep an eye on cook time though, as some GF pastas cook faster than wheat-based ones.

Why does my mac & cheese sometimes dry out? Two tricks: 1) Don’t overcook the pasta initially – al dente is perfect since it’ll keep cooking in the air fryer. 2) Make sure your dish isn’t too shallow – deeper dishes help retain moisture better.

Can I double this recipe? You bet! Just use a larger air fryer-safe dish and add a few extra minutes to the cook time. Give it a stir halfway and check for that perfect golden top.

What if my cheese sauce is lumpy? Don’t panic! A quick blitz with an immersion blender or vigorous whisking usually smooths it right out. Next time, make sure your cheeses are room temp and add them gradually on low heat.

Description

A creamy and indulgent five-cheese mac & cheese made easily in your air fryer.


Ingredients

  • 8 oz elbow macaroni
  • 2 tbsp butter
  • 2 tbsp all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up milk
  • 1/2 cup heavy cream
  • 1/2 cup cheddar cheese, shredded
  • 1/2 cup mozzarella cheese, shredded
  • 1/4 cup gouda cheese, shredded
  • 1/4 cup parmesan cheese, grated
  • 1/4 cup cream cheese, cubed
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per
  • 1/4 tsp paprika


Instructions

  1. Cook macaroni according to package instructions, then drain.
  2. Melt butter in a saucepan over medium heat. Stir in flour to make a roux.
  3. Gradually whisk in milk and heavy cream until smooth.
  4. Add cheddar, mozzarella, gouda, parmesan, and cream cheese. Stir until melted.
  5. Season with salt, pepper, and paprika.
  6. Combine cheese sauce with cooked macaroni.
  7. Transfer mixture to an air fryer-safe dish.
  8. Air fry at 350°F for 10-12 minutes until bubbly and golden.
  9. Let cool slightly before serving.

Notes

  • Use room-temperature cheeses for smoother melting.
  • For extra crispiness, broil for 1-2 minutes after air frying.
  • Stir the mac & cheese halfway through cooking for even browning.
